-ling¹ Definition
-ling (liŋ)
- small or young (person or thing specified) duckling
- one related to a (specified) thing, esp. so as to seem unimportant or contemptible hireling, earthling
-ling² Definition
-ling (liŋ)
Now Chiefly Dial. in a (specified) manner, condition, or direction; to a (specified) extent darkling
Etymology: ME -linge < OE -ling, -lang < IE base *lenk-, to bend > Latvian lùnkans, flexible
